Case Name D.O.B.: Cause No. "Felony Firearm Offender Registration" Attachment: Registration for Felony Firearm Offenders (If required, attach to the judgment and sentence.) 1. General Applicability and Requirements: The defendant is required to register because this crime involves a felony firearm offense as defined in RCW 9.41.010, and: after considering statutory factors, the court decided the defendant must register; or the offense was committed in conjunction with an offense committed against a person under the age of 18, or a serious violent offense or offense involving sexual motivation as defined in RCW 9.94A.030. If the defendant resides in this state, the defendant must personally register with the county sheriff for the county of the defendant's residence, whether or not the defendant has a fixed residence. The defendant must register with the county sheriff within 48-hours after the date: (a) of release from custody of the state department of corrections, the state department of social and health services, a local division of youth services, or a local jail or juvenile detention facility for this offense; or (b) the court imposes the defendant's sentence, if the defendant receives a sentence that does not include confinement. 2. Register on Every 12-month Anniversary: The defendant must register with the county sheriff not later than 20 days after each 12-month anniversary of the date the defendant is first required to register as described in paragraph 1, above. If the defendant is confined in any correctional institution, state institution or facility, or health care facility throughout the 20-day period after each 12-month anniversary, the defendant must personally appear before the county sheriff not later than 48-hours after release to verify and update, as appropriate, the defendant's registration. 3. Change of Residence within State: If the defendant changes residence and the new residence address is in this state, the defendant must register with the sheriff of the county of the defendant's residence address not later than 48 hours after the change of address. If the defendant changes residence within a county, the defendant must update the current registration. 4. Length of Duty to Register: The defendant must continue to register for four years from the date the defendant is first required to register, as described in paragraph 1, above.
